Polycythemia Vera Treatment Options: From Traditional to Cutting-Edge

Updated: Sep 14

Polycythemia Vera (PV) is a rare blood disorder characterized by an overproduction of red blood cells, leading to thickened blood and a range of complications, including blood clots, strokes, and heart attacks. Managing this condition effectively is crucial to prevent serious health issues. Fortunately, there are several treatment options available for Polycythemia Vera, ranging from traditional approaches to cutting-edge therapies. Traditional Treatment for Polycythemia Vera


1. Phlebotomy


Phlebotomy is one of the oldest and most common treatments for Polycythemia Vera. It involves the removal of a certain amount of blood from the patient's body to reduce the red blood cell count and decrease blood viscosity. This procedure is similar to donating blood and is usually performed regularly, depending on the patient’s hematocrit levels. Phlebotomy effectively alleviates symptoms such as headaches, dizziness, and visual disturbances, but it may need to be complemented with other treatments.


2. Low-Dose Aspirin


Low-dose aspirin is often prescribed as a remedy for Polycythemia Vera to reduce the risk of blood clots. Aspirin works by thinning the blood, which helps prevent clot formation. This treatment is particularly important for patients with PV, as they are at a higher risk of developing thrombotic events, such as heart attacks or strokes. Aspirin is generally well-tolerated and is used in conjunction with other treatments.


3. Medications


Cytoreductive therapies, such as hydroxyurea, are often used as a treatment for Polycythemia Vera to control blood cell production. Hydroxyurea works by inhibiting the bone marrow's ability to produce excessive blood cells, helping to maintain a safer hematocrit level. Another medication, interferon-alpha, is sometimes used, particularly in younger patients or those who are pregnant, as it is considered safer than other cytoreductive agents. These medications help reduce symptoms and lower the risk of complications, although they may have side effects.


Advanced and Cutting-Edge Treatments


1. Ruxolitinib (Jakafi)


Ruxolitinib is a more recent addition to the treatment options for Polycythemia Vera. It is a JAK2 inhibitor, specifically designed to target the genetic mutation (JAK2 V617F) present in most PV patients. By inhibiting this mutation, Ruxolitinib helps to control blood cell production, reduce spleen size, and alleviate symptoms such as itching, night sweats, and fatigue. This medication is particularly beneficial for patients who do not respond well to traditional therapies.

3. Lifestyle Modifications


In addition to medical treatments, lifestyle modifications play an essential role in managing Polycythemia Vera. Regular exercise, maintaining a healthy weight, and avoiding smoking are all crucial in reducing the risk of complications associated with PV. Patients should also stay hydrated to prevent blood thickening and monitor their condition regularly with their healthcare provider.
